区块链是一种去中心化的分布式账本技术。随着科技的迅猛发展,它正在逐渐渗透到各个行业,特别是金融领域。区...
在区块链的世界里,测试链(Testnet)是开发者进行项目测试和功能验证的重要环境。TP钱包作为一款流行的多链钱包,支持多种区块链网络,包括OK测试链。本篇文章将详细介绍如何在TP钱包中设置OK测试链,并解答一些相关问题。
## 2. 什么是TP钱包?TP钱包是一个去中心化的多链数字资产管理工具,支持丰富的区块链技术和代币。作为一款功能强大的钱包,TP钱包提供了快速、安全和便捷的数字资产管理体验。用户可以通过TP钱包管理他们的以太坊、比特币、OK链等数字资产。
## 3. 什么是OK测试链?OK测试链是OKEx平台推出的一个区块链测试网络,供开发者创建和测试智能合约、DApp等。由于测试链的资源相对丰富和灵活,因此它成为开发者们首选的测试环境。在测试链中,用户可以免费获取测试币来进行交易和功能验证,而不会消耗真实资产。
## 4. 如何在TP钱包中设置OK测试链? ### 4.1 下载并安装TP钱包要使用TP钱包,首先需要从应用商店或官网下载并安装TP钱包。安装完成后,打开钱包并选择“创建钱包”或“导入钱包”以获得一个钱包地址。
### 4.2 添加OK测试链网络打开TP钱包后,点击右上角的网络选项,进入网络设置页面。在这里,用户可以添加新的网络。从可选网络列表中选择“添加自定义网络”。
### 4.3 填入OK测试链信息在添加自定义网络的界面中,用户需要填写以下信息:
输入完毕后,保存设置并选择OK测试链作为当前网络。
### 4.4 获取测试币在OK测试链上进行交易之前,需要获取一些测试币。用户可以访问OKEx官方的测试币发放网站,通过填写自己的钱包地址申请测试币。测试币会快速到账,同样用于进行链上交易或智能合约交互。
## 5. 在OK测试链上操作的注意事项在使用OK测试链时,用户应当注意以下几点:
TP钱包作为一款去中心化的钱包,其安全性和隐私性受多方因素影响。首先,TP钱包采用了加密技术保护用户的私钥和交易信息。用户的私钥储存在本地设备中,钱包开发方并不存储用户的任何敏感数据,这样可以最大限度地保证用户的隐私。
其次,TP钱包提供了助记词功能,用户在创建钱包时会生成一组助记词。这组助记词是钱包的唯一通行证,且用户应确保妥善保存。如果钱包丢失,用户可以使用助记词恢复钱包,确保资产的安全。
最后,TP钱包定期更新其安全策略和体系结构,以防范潜在的安全威胁。因此,用户在使用TP钱包时,可以享受相对较高的安全性和隐私性。
### 怎样获取OK测试链的最新信息?获取OK测试链的最新信息是开发者和用户了解网络状态和功能变化的重要途径。一般来说,用户可以通过以下几个渠道获取信息:
除了以上渠道,用户还可时常访问OK测试链的区块浏览器,确认测试链上的实时数据和交易情况。
### 怎么解决无法连接到OK测试链的问题?在使用OK测试链时,有时用户可能会遇到无法连接到网络的问题,以下是一些解决方法:
如以上方法均无法解决问题,建议联系TP钱包的客服或在社交媒体上发帖寻求帮助。
### OK测试链与主网的区别是什么?OK测试链和主网的主要区别在于其用途和环境设置。
首先,OK测试链主要用于开发和测试,用户在测试链上进行交易和合约执行时,不涉及真实的数字资产。测试链上常常得到免费的测试币,重点在于对应用程序的调试和功能实现的验证。而主网则是实际运行的区块链环境,用户在这里进行真实的代币交易,一切操作都涉及真实的资产,需要小心谨慎。
其次,测试链的资源相对丰富,可以重复创建和销毁数据,不会产生资金的损失。但在主网中,所有的交易和资产都是真实存在的,错误的操作可能会导致无法弥补的损失。因此在主网中进行开发和操作时,开发者和用户都需具备较强的经验。
最后,测试链的更新相对灵活和快速,可以在没有风险的基础上进行新技术的尝试,而主网的更新通常是经过严格的测试和多个阶段才能推出。用户应根据不同的需求选择相应的环境进行操作。
### 如何使用OK测试链进行DApp开发?使用OK测试链进行DApp开发通常遵循以下步骤:
第一步是环境准备。开发者需要安装开发环境,常用的有Node.js、Truffle、Ganache等工具。这些工具可以提供代码开发、合约编译和链上部署等必要的功能。
第二步是编写智能合约。开发者通过Solidity等语言编写符合需求的智能合约。在编程时要注意合约的安全性和可扩展性,以减少日后可能出现的问题。
第三步是合约的测试与调试。使用OK测试链环境,开发者可以将编写好的智能合约进行编译并部署到测试链上。此时,需要通过交易或调用合约的各项功能,验证合约的运行效果,并测试在不同情况下的表现。
第四步是前端搭建。DApp的前端与传统应用不同,其前端需要与链上的数据进行交互。这通常需要使用Web3.js或Ethers.js等库进行链上数据的读取和更新。同时,确保用户可以通过TP钱包连接DApp,进行资产管理和交互。
最后一步是发布上线。在确保DApp经过充分测试后,开发者可以选择将其上线到主网。发布前要再次确认合约的安全性和逻辑准确性,以确保不会在真实交易中出现问题。
## 7. 结语本文详细介绍了如何在TP钱包中设置OK测试链的步骤,同时对相关问题进行了深入分析。随着区块链技术的不断发展,测试链的重要性愈加凸显,特别是在智能合约和DApp的开发过程中。希望能通过本篇文章,帮助用户顺利设置和使用OK测试链,开展各种有趣的区块链项目。